Are you a
passionate Speech and Language Therapist who values a neurodiversity-affirming
approach? We invite you to join our innovative and compassionate
multidisciplinary therapy team at The Mendip School, a highly
successful 4 -19 special school based in Shepton Mallet.
We are a
forward-thinking and innovative therapy team comprised of an
Occupational Therapist (Therapy Team Lead), Speech and Language Therapist,
Music Therapist, Drama Therapist, Art Therapist and Therapy Support Workers. We
strive to be neurodiversity affirming and trauma informed in our
approach. We work collaboratively with class teams and run a number
of whole class interventions. Our work environment fosters creativity,
joint working, current practice and a flexible approach.
The appointed therapist will be responsible for providing assessment, advice and interventions for our students. We are looking for a therapist with an interest in working with our upper primary and secondary age students who are primarily Autistic with speech and language needs. The role provides the opportunity to carry out individual, small group and class-based interventions using evidence-based approaches within the school day. The post will be in addition to the current Speech and Language Therapist and will allow us to build on and expand the current provision.
The postholder
will have the opportunity to support the exciting, continued development of our
growing therapy team provision including whole school projects for AAC,
interoception, Gestalt Language Processing and therapy group
interventions. The post is flexible and there is the opportunity to work
collaboratively with the current Speech and Language Therapist to share the
responsibilities based on experience and areas of interest. The postholder will
have the opportunity to work jointly on projects with other therapists. The
therapy team work collaboratively with teaching staff and the appointed
therapist will deliver training to staff as required. We offer robust CPD
opportunities and access to regular external clinical supervision.
